Output 4b1e17f79bc88fafeb7e23b522ca2f29ec788928bb6270f07ccd128d758306f6:0

value
585779436
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76c3e8b1fe83bfdd7928acce6e11af84ade572ac7d9c540cd8ef65e6034d9674
address
tb1pwmp73v07swla67fg4n8xuyd0sjk72u4v0kw9grxcaaj7vq6dje6qya6q43
transaction
4b1e17f79bc88fafeb7e23b522ca2f29ec788928bb6270f07ccd128d758306f6
confirmations
21782
spent
true